    Official wording: Potentially Hazardous Food Meets Temperature Requirement During Storage, Preparation Display And Service
    Inspector note: Observed potentially hazardous food stored in 1 door Norpole reach in cooler at improper temperature of: 46.7f, 4lbs of macaroni and cheese, at a value of $35.00: date 3/12/18 47.5f, 6lbs of raw chicken breast, at a value of $15.00: date 3/8/18 Manager voluntarily discarded and denatured a total weight of 10LBS, at a value of $50.00 Internal temperature of 1 door cooler at time of inspection was 37.6f Informed manager that potentially hazardous foods must be kept at 40f or lower for cold foods and 140f or more for hot foods at all times.
